The human soul is hungry for beauty. We seek it everywhere…When we experience the Beautiful, there is a sense of homecoming.” – John O’Donohue

What is this sense of homecoming? I think it happens when the beauty outside us and the beauty inside us recognize each other and brighten with delight. It’s like friends who find each other after searching in a crowd. There’s a relief, gratitude, joyful embracing, and a sense of homecoming.

About this hunger. Besides beauty, souls hunger for peace. Hearts hunger for hope. Many among us hunger for food too.  

We can help nourish souls and encourage each other. We can help feed hungry bellies too Let’s do what we can.
